Frequently Asked Questions

What is the population and demographic makeup of ZIP code 67357?

The total population of ZIP code 67357 is approximately 10,931. The largest age group is 35-64 year olds. This demographic data is sourced from the U.S. Census Bureau.

Do more people rent or own homes in ZIP code 67357?

The housing market in ZIP code 67357 is predominantly driven by homeowners, with 71% of housing units being owner-occupied and 29% being renter-occupied.
